Hibiscus meraukensis

Finished watercolour by Fred Polydore Nodder from an original outine drawing by Sydney Parkinson made during Captain James Cooks first voyage across the Pacific, 1768-1771

EDITORS COMMENTS
This stunning watercolour painting depicts Hibiscus meraukensis, a beautiful and intricately detailed flowering plant from the Malvaceae family. The painting is a finished work by Fred Polydore Nodder, based on an original outline drawing made by Sydney Parkinson during Captain James Cook's historic first voyage across the Pacific Ocean from 1768 to 1771. Captain Cook's voyage was a groundbreaking exploration that expanded European knowledge of the Pacific world, and the natural world was no exception. Parkinson, as the official artist on board, meticulously documented the diverse flora and fauna they encountered, including this magnificent Hibiscus meraukensis. As an angiosperm, dicot, and eudicot, Hibiscus meraukensis is a member of the flowering plants, specifically the Malvales order and the Rosid clade. The plant is native to the Pacific islands and is characterized by its large, vibrant flowers, which can grow up to 15 centimeters in diameter. The flower's petals are typically bright red, orange, or yellow, and its center is filled with intricate, golden stamen. This watercolour painting by Fred Polydore Nodder is a testament to the beauty and intricacy of the natural world, as documented by some of the most intrepid explorers in history. The painting's vibrant colors and fine details bring the Hibiscus meraukensis to life, transporting us back to the Pacific islands of the 18th century and reminding us of the wonders that still await us in the natural world.
